Ing to the Mississippi Public Records Act of 1983, public records are considered public property and are open to inspection by any person.
Requests may be mailed, hand delivered, transmitted via facsimile to (601) 359-1499, or emailed to publicrecords@sos.ms.gov.

The Public Records Act ensures public access to public records in the possession of governmental entities in Mississippi. The Ethics Commission has authority to take complaints, issue subpoenas, hold hearings and issue orders involving alleged violations of the Public Records Act.
The Mississippi Code of 1972 Title 25 Chapter 61 establishes the Mississippi Public Records Act. It is the policy of the Legislature that public records must be available for inspection by any person unless otherwise provided by this act [Laws, 1996, ch. 453].
For example, academic records, personnel files, and trade secrets are exempt from disclosure.
